> On Do 28 Nov 2013 11:20:07 CET, Marco André Dinis wrote:
>
>> I want to have a single session and have that session shared over
>> network..
>>
>> It's a Virtual Machine, i want to access it via SPICE and via X2Go.
>> But it must be the same session.
>> When i try to connect via X2GoClient using any other method (except
>> the SHADOW mode) it creates another session.
>> I should not use x2godesktopsharing?
>>
>> Or am i doing something wrong?
>
>
> The question is:
>
> Are the users running the X(2Go) session and attempting to start the shadow
> session identical???
>
> If yes, then simply use the session type ,,Connection to a local desktop''.
>
> Within the X(2Go) session you do _not_ have to start the X2Go Desktop
> Sharing tool. It works without if the user who wants to shadow is identical
> with the user running the X(2Go) session.
